Business man who sues in the name of non-existent company is charged with paying case evaluation sanctions, personally

Peter Stanaj filed a suit against the Salisbury Investment Group in the name of "the Stanaj investment Group" alleging breach of contract.  He rejected a proposed case evaluation settlement, however, and then lost his case.  The defendants belatedly pointed out that the Stanaj Investment Group was not a legally-registered entity and sought case evaluations against Stanaj personally.  Although the court suggested that the defendants should have raised the issue earlier, it upheld a $15,000.00 award of sanctions against Stanaj personally.
